Understanding Maker Debris Safety Nets

Maker debris safety nets are essential tools in various crafting and manufacturing environments. These nets are designed to catch and contain debris generated during the creation of products, ensuring safety for workers and maintaining a clean workspace. They can be especially beneficial in settings where sharp or hazardous materials are present, reducing the risk of accidents and injuries.

In addition to safety benefits, these nets also contribute to improved productivity. By preventing debris from scattering across work areas, they help maintain an organized environment, allowing creators to focus on their tasks without distractions. This organization can lead to faster completion times and higher quality output.

Features of Maker Debris Safety Nets

Maker debris safety nets come with a variety of features tailored for diverse applications. Many models are made from durable, lightweight materials that allow for easy installation and removal. This portability is crucial for makers who frequently change their setup or need to transport their work to different locations.

Some safety nets are designed with adjustable sizing options, making them versatile enough to fit various workspaces. This adaptability ensures that no matter the size or shape of the area, the net can effectively capture debris without hindering the maker’s workflow.

Best Practices for Using Maker Debris Safety Nets

To maximize the effectiveness of maker debris safety nets, it is important to follow best practices for usage. Regularly inspecting the nets for wear and tear can prevent failures that could lead to safety hazards. Additionally, proper placement of the nets around workstations can enhance their ability to capture debris effectively.

Furthermore, combining the use of safety nets with other safety measures, such as personal protective equipment (PPE) and proper ventilation, creates a comprehensive safety strategy. This holistic approach not only protects the makers but also promotes a culture of safety within the workspace, encouraging all team members to prioritize their well-being.
